The Invention of Virtual Reality Technology

In 1935, fiction writer Stanley G. Weinbaum wrote a short story named Pygmalion's Spectacles. It talked about a gadget that could create a fictional, virtual world through holographic. Virtual reality technology has its roots in the 19th century. But it was the mid-20th century when the concept of VR began to take shape.

Ivan Sutherland, a computer scientist, was considered one of the few people to explore a VR system in 1968. He developed a head-mounted display (HMD) in 1968. Although the technology was extremely elementary, it laid the groundwork for future VR systems.

Years 1980s and 1990s made this technology more accessible. 21st century started observing the ultimate progress of technology. In 2012, the development of the Oculus Rift headset was one of the significant phases of VR development. It was designed specifically for gaming and offered a more realistic and immersive experience than any earlier VR system.

Today, there are various companies in the market that develop VR gadgets and VR experiences. Virtual reality is seen in various forms and domains. For example, VR can be used as an educational tool and it can be a great prototyping tool for the manufacturing industry.

Immersive Experiences

VR allows users to enter a fully innovative and interactive virtual world. A user can get completely immersed in a virtual environment. It differs a lot from other technologies. Let us understand it with an example.

Earlier online teaching has a 2D face. While virtual reality brings immersive nature with its 3D elements. Students can walk through various educational models. They can roam around various industrial plants in VR. It transforms the educational experience from passive to active learning. This kind of immersive experience has the potential to revolutionize how we learn and how we entertain ourselves.

Enhanced healthcare

Healthcare is one of the irreplaceable domains of human life. Immersive technologies such as virtual reality and metaverse elevate the healthcare experience. For example, VR can be used for patient care. It is used for distractive treatments for patient cure. In addition, medical education has the impactful benefits of VR technology. It can teach students about various subjects and helps students train about surgeries. In addition, medical professionals can get hands-on experience using various virtual medical tools and instruments without any harm to instruments and patients.
